Boys and girls teams from Russell Vale, Figtree, Wollongong Olympic, Fernhill and Lake Heights all tasted success in the elite statewide knockout competition.
In the under 12 girls, Russell Vale kicked things off on Sunday with a 2-1 win over Strathfield as Shellharbour’s boys team fell 2-1 to Balmain.
The under 13 boys were successful when Figtree beat Abbotsford 4-1.
Both under 14s teams got up as Wollongong Olympic (boys) smashed Hurlstone Park Wanderers 5-0 and Fernhill (girls) beat Earlwood Wanderers 2-0.
In the under 16’s, Lake Heights (boys) edged out Balmain 1-0. The under 16 girls team from Shellharbour fell 2-0 to Leichhardt.
Balgownie were just narrowly beaten in the under 17 boys in a tense 3-2 loss to Abbotsford.
Clubs will play the next round of matches on October 8
